please help to modify this peace of server code for bidirectional stream in 
order to make it work correclty with *multiple clients* at one time. 
Currently it crashes with segmentation fault in the proto_utils.h.

class RouteGuideImpl final : public RouteGuide::CallbackService {
 public:
  explicit RouteGuideImpl(const std::string& db) {
    routeguide::ParseDb(db, &feature_list_);
  }  

  grpc::ServerBidiReactor<RouteNote, RouteNote>* RouteChat(
      CallbackServerContext* context) override {
    class Chatter : public grpc::ServerBidiReactor<RouteNote, RouteNote> {
     public:
      Chatter(absl::Mutex* mu, std::vector<RouteNote>* received_notes)
          : mu_(mu), received_notes_(received_notes) {
        StartRead(&note_);
      }

      void OnDone() override { delete this; }
      void OnReadDone(bool ok) override {
        if (ok) {
          // Unlike the other example in this directory that's not using
          // the reactor pattern, we can't grab a local lock to secure the
          // access to the notes vector, because the reactor will most 
likely
          // make us jump threads, so we'll have to use a different locking
          // strategy. We'll grab the lock locally to build a copy of the
          // list of nodes we're going to send, then we'll grab the lock
          // again to append the received note to the existing vector.
          mu_->Lock();
          std::copy_if(received_notes_->begin(), received_notes_->end(),
                       std::back_inserter(to_send_notes_),
                       [this](const RouteNote& note) {
                         return note.location().latitude() ==
                                    note_.location().latitude() &&
                                note.location().longitude() ==
                                    note_.location().longitude();
                       });
          mu_->Unlock();
          notes_iterator_ = to_send_notes_.begin();
          NextWrite();
        } else {
          std::cout << "some client finished" << std::endl;
          Finish(Status::OK);
        }
      }
      void OnWriteDone(bool /*ok*/) override { NextWrite(); }

     private:
      void NextWrite() {
        if (notes_iterator_ != to_send_notes_.end()) {
          StartWrite(&*notes_iterator_);
          notes_iterator_++;
        } else {
          mu_->Lock();
          received_notes_->push_back(note_);
          mu_->Unlock();
          StartRead(&note_);
        }
      }
      RouteNote note_;
      absl::Mutex* mu_;
      std::vector<RouteNote>* received_notes_;
      std::vector<RouteNote> to_send_notes_;
      std::vector<RouteNote>::iterator notes_iterator_;
    };
    return new Chatter(&mu_, &received_notes_);
  }

 private:
  std::vector<Feature> feature_list_;
  absl::Mutex mu_;
  std::vector<RouteNote> received_notes_ ABSL_GUARDED_BY(mu_);
};
